Recently, there is a trend that some firms considered to withdraw their manufacturing plants
from their local countries, which are nearly losing growth potential, to establish new ones in
other countries that can give the lucrative opportunities for competitive advantage.

GOLDEN GALAXY is a global network of management consultancy firms providing


advisory services in many countries. GOLDEN GALAXY was established in several years
ago and now is the one of the largest professional service firms with a balanced mix of
international and local clients, helping them to mitigate risks and grasp opportunities in
global business environment. Its mission statement is ‘To help our clients make significant
and lasting improvements to performance in a global, digitalised world'.

The business aims to support and help its clients grow and build capabilities and leadership
skills at every level, especially in the areas of digital and ecommerce. The focus is on
working with organisations that want to expand their global reach and manage the challenges
and complexities that result from operating in an international and global context. Typical
consultancy projects take between one to six months. One Senior Partner is attached to the
projects, together with an Engagement Manager and two or three Business Analysts.

The company publishes an industry review called Global Business Quarterly – a ‘thought
leadership’ publication that provides insights into both current and prospective clients.

Assignment activity and guidance


The overall aim of the industry review is to address the complexities associated with
operating in a global environment for businesses in general and for companies of the
specified industry in specific. To further support the readers' understanding of the research
purpose, you will need to analyse the key factors that are driving globalisation in general
first. You are required to research and produce the industry review; it should include the
followings:
 An introduction to the concept of globalisation.
 An analysis of key factors that drive globalisation and trade, with reference to
cultural, economic, political and social dimensions, and the complexities this
necessitates.
 A critical analysis and evaluation of the impact that these factors have on the
business environment in terms of opportunities and challenges.
 Evaluation of the impact of digital technologies on globalisation and the role of
innovation.
 Recommendations on how organisations can respond to, and thrive in, a globalised,
digitalised world.
The industry report should include contemporary examples, as well as reference to relevant
academic theory and models.

Assignment activity and guidance


The client's company currently operates in only one country and has been successful in its
local market, but is now facing increased competiton and stagnant growth. Because of this

5
current situation, the client is looking to expand its operations into new international
markets. The client in the inquiry has asked for help in developing a global strategy that will
fully support organisational resource allocation and decision making. You will also need to
consider how the international business operations run, the importance of culture awareness
and differences, and its link to effective leadership and organisational structure.

You have been asked to prepare and deliver a business case presentation to the client,
outlining a framework for a global strategy. Having discussed this in detail with your fellow
analysts and your Senior Partner, you agree that the business case will need to include the
following.
1. An appropriate introduction and the purpose of the business case.
2. An evaluation of the different decision-making models available to your client
operating in a global environment.
3. A critical evaluation of the influences of globalisation on governance, leadership and
organisational structure, making use of McKinsey’s 7S model.
4. An evaluation of how ethical, sustainable and cultural factors will influence the
global operations of your client.
5. Suggested objectives and strategies developed to achieve competitive advantage for
your client and satisfy the needs of different stakeholders in a global context. Valid
and justified recommendations of how your client might adapt its organisational
structure and strategy to optimise responsiveness and decision making in a global
context.
6. Valid and justified recommendations of how your client might adapt its
organisational structure and strategy to optimise responsiveness and decision making
in a global context.

Your business case should also include recommendations for how the company can leverage
its existing resources and capabilities to support its global expansion, and a plan for
implementating the global business strategy.

In addition to this, you will also be required to deliver a presentation to the company's
executive team, outlining your findings and recommendations. The presentation should be
visually engaging and highlight the key points of your report.
